Softball Recap: Spencer County Bears vs. Shelby County Rockets
After flying high against Cornerstone Christian Academy on Friday, Spencer County came back down to earth. The Bears fell just short of the Shelby County Rockets by a score of 10-8 on Sunday. The Bears haven't had much luck with the Rockets recently, as the team has come up short the last three times they've met.
Annalee Wood was a force to be reckoned with on the mound despite the final result: she struck out seven batters over 4.1 innings while giving up just one earned (and five unearned) runs off five hits. She has been consistent for a while: she hasn't given up more than one earned run in ten consecutive appearances.

On the hitting side, Spencer County saw nine different players step up and record at least one hit. One of them was Madi Walker, who went 2-for-4 with two stolen bases and two runs. Walker has been hot recently, having posted two or more stolen bases the last three times she's played. Layla Maraman was another, going 2-for-5 with one run and one RBI.
Spencer County now has a losing record of 16-17. As for Shelby County, the victory got them back to even at 13-13.
